TD’s Night It Up! Concrete Classic Results

The Toronto Phoenix Women’s A team spent the past weekend competing at TD’s Night It Up Concrete Classic.  They played a wonderful tournament and were undefeated going into the finals.  Unfortunately, they fell short at the end, taking Outtahand to a full 3-set match (19-25, 25-20, 12-15).  It was a very hot weekend, full of festivities at the Night It Up night market and we are very proud of all the girls that competed in the tournament!

Congratulations Anson!

5249_119234843054_6496151_nThe “9-Man” Documentary Team is currently accepting votes for their Legends of 9-Man survey and inductees will be featured on their very own throwback trading card!

We are very proud of Anson Wong for being nominated in the MODERN category and representing Toronto Phoenix all throughout the North American 9-man circuit.  Anson has been with the club for over 15 years and is truly dedicated to the club.  Not only did he play for Toronto Phoenix but he also coached the Women’s A team and was part of the Toronto Phoenix executive committee for many years past.  (For those of us that know Anson, he’s also usually responsible for the Phoenix socials and any rookie initiations that he decides to carry out.)  This year, he decided to take on a smaller role within the club in order spend more time with his family, Aya and Aleena, but is still strongly committed to helping coach the Men’s A team for the summer.  He has definitely contributed a lot to Toronto Phoenix, on and off the court.
